News by Chris Gould
Starring: Dev Patel
Released: 1st June 2009
SRP: £19.99 (DVD £24.99 (BD)
Further Details:
Pathé Distribution Ltd. has announced the DVD and Blu-ray release of Slumdog Millionaire for the 1st of June, priced at around £19.99 and £24.99 respectively. A list of confirmed bonus material can be found below, along with the artwork.
DVD Release
- Commentary from Director Danny Boyle and Dev Patel
- Commentary from Producer Christian Colson and Writer Simon Beaufoy
- Deleted Scenes
- Slumdog Dreams: Danny Boyle and the Making of Slumdog Millionaire
- Jai Ho Remix: Slumdog Cutdown
- UK Theatrical Trailer

Blu-ray Release
- Commentary from Director Danny Boyle and Dev Patel
- Commentary from Producer Christian Colson and Writer Simon Beaufoy
- Deleted Scenes
- Slumdog Dreams: Danny Boyle and the Making of Slumdog Millionaire
- Jai Ho Remix: Slumdog Cutdown
- UK Theatrical Trailer
- Slumdog Discovered: Exclusive Picture-in-Picture Interviews
- From Script to Screen: The Toilet Scene
- Indian Short Film: Manjha
- Bombay Liquid Dance
